1180 | benjamin-moore | HEX: #C0988A | RGB: 192, 152, 138

Benjamin Moore Rosedale 1180: A Timeless Hue for Versatile Spaces

Benjamin Moore Rosedale 1180 is a soft and inviting shade that evokes a sense of understated elegance and timeless charm. This color is a light, muted taupe with warm undertones, making it a sophisticated choice for a wide variety of design styles, from classic to modern. Its subtle warmth and versatility give it the ability to create cozy, harmonious spaces while maintaining a sense of refined simplicity.

Undertones of Benjamin Moore Rosedale 1180

Rosedale 1180 carries warm beige undertones that lean slightly towards a taupe-gray blend, offering a balanced and neutral appearance. These undertones make it an excellent choice for spaces where you want to create a calm and serene atmosphere. The warmth prevents it from feeling too cold or stark, while the muted nature of the hue ensures it doesn’t appear too yellow or overly saturated. This balance of warm and neutral undertones allows Rosedale 1180 to adapt beautifully to different lighting conditions, making it a versatile option for both naturally lit spaces and rooms with artificial lighting.

Coordinating Colors to Complement Rosedale 1180

One of the standout features of Rosedale 1180 is its ability to pair seamlessly with a wide range of colors, enhancing its versatility in interior design. Here are some coordinating color suggestions to create a cohesive and stylish palette:

  • Benjamin Moore Simply White (OC-117): A crisp, clean white that pairs beautifully with Rosedale 1180 to create a bright and airy look. Use Simply White for trim, ceilings, or cabinetry to highlight the warmth of Rosedale.

  • Benjamin Moore Sea Haze (2137-50): A soft, muted green-gray that works well as an accent color, adding depth and contrast without overwhelming the space.

  • Benjamin Moore Kendall Charcoal (HC-166): For a more dramatic effect, pair Rosedale 1180 with this rich, deep gray. This combination creates a sophisticated and modern look, perfect for accent walls or furniture.

  • Benjamin Moore Wrought Iron (2124-10): A bold, near-black shade that adds a touch of drama and contrast when used sparingly alongside Rosedale.

  • Benjamin Moore Revere Pewter (HC-172): Another neutral with taupe undertones, this color creates a layered and cohesive look when paired with Rosedale.

Best Uses for Benjamin Moore Rosedale 1180

Rosedale 1180 is a versatile color that lends itself well to a variety of spaces and design applications. Here are some of the best ways to incorporate this timeless hue into your home:

  • Living Rooms: The warm neutrality of Rosedale makes it an excellent choice for living rooms, where it creates a welcoming and comfortable environment. Pair it with plush furnishings, textured rugs, and coordinating accent colors for a polished look.

  • Bedrooms: With its calming undertones, Rosedale 1180 is ideal for bedrooms. Use it on walls to set a tranquil tone, and combine it with layers of soft linens, warm wood furniture, and subtle metallic accents for a serene retreat.

  • Kitchens: Rosedale works beautifully in kitchens, especially when paired with white cabinetry and natural stone countertops. Its neutral warmth balances well with both modern and traditional kitchen designs.

  • Home Offices: Create a productive yet soothing workspace by using Rosedale 1180 as the primary wall color. Pair it with darker furniture and natural wood tones for a professional and grounded feel.

  • Bathrooms: For a spa-like atmosphere, use Rosedale in bathrooms alongside crisp whites, soft grays, and metallic fixtures. Its versatility allows it to complement both modern and classic bathroom styles.
